You can also try this :

df = DataFrame(series).transpose()

Using the transpose() function you can interchange the indices and the columns. The output looks like this :

    a   b   c
0   1   2   3
Answer from PJay on Stack Overflow
🌐
Pandas
pandas.pydata.org › docs › reference › api › pandas.Series.html
pandas.Series — pandas 3.0.3 documentation
Contains data stored in Series. If data is a dict, argument order is maintained. Unordered sets are not supported. ... Values must be hashable and have the same length as data. Non-unique index values are allowed. Will default to RangeIndex (0, 1, 2, …, n) if not provided.
🌐
Spark By {Examples}
sparkbyexamples.com › home › pandas › pandas – create dataframe from multiple series
Pandas - Create DataFrame From Multiple Series - Spark By {Examples}
November 7, 2024 - If you have a multiple series and wanted to create a pandas DataFrame by appending each series as a columns to DataFrame, you can use concat() method. In
🌐
Vultr Docs
docs.vultr.com › python › third-party › pandas › Series › to_frame
Python Pandas Series to_frame() - Convert to DataFrame | Vultr Docs
December 27, 2024 - By using pd.concat(), multiple Series can be merged side-by-side, forming a DataFrame with each Series as a column. This feature is particularly useful when merging data from different sources or aligning features for machine learning inputs. Efficiently converting a Series to a DataFrame with the to_frame() method ...
🌐
Statology
statology.org › home › how to create pandas dataframe from series (with examples)
How to Create Pandas DataFrame from Series (With Examples)
November 1, 2021 - The following examples show how to create a pandas DataFrame using existing series as either the rows or columns of the DataFrame.
🌐
GeeksforGeeks
geeksforgeeks.org › creating-a-dataframe-from-pandas-series
Creating a dataframe from Pandas series - GeeksforGeeks
September 29, 2023 - After creating the Series, we created a dictionary and passed Series objects as values of the dictionary, and the keys of the dictionary will be served as Columns of the Dataframe.
🌐
TutorialsPoint
tutorialspoint.com › creating-a-dataframe-from-pandas-series
Creating a Dataframe from Pandas series
April 20, 2023 - Numbers Fruits 0 10 apple 1 20 orange 2 30 banana 3 40 grape 4 50 watermelon · When we have a DataFrame and we want to add a new column to it, we can do this by creating a new series object and then using the `pd.concat()` method to concatenate the two data frames along the columns axis. import ...
Find elsewhere
🌐
W3Schools
w3schools.com › python › pandas › pandas_series.asp
Pandas Series
Create a Series using only data ... Pandas are usually multi-dimensional tables, called DataFrames. Series is like a column, a DataFrame is the whole table....
🌐
Python Guides
pythonguides.com › pandas-series-to-dataframe-python
Ways to Convert a Pandas Series to a DataFrame in Python
February 18, 2026 - Sometimes you don’t want your Series to become a column; you want it to become a single row in a DataFrame. I’ve used this when creating “Summary” or “Total” rows for a larger financial report. To do this, you can convert the Series to a DataFrame and then use the .T attribute to transpose it. import pandas as pd # Series representing a single record (e.g., a customer in a US retail store) customer_record = pd.Series(['John Doe', 'New York', 'Gold'], index=['Name', 'Location', 'Member_Level']) # Converting and Transposing df_row = customer_record.to_frame().T print(df_row)
🌐
Arab Psychology
scales.arabpsychology.com › home › how to easily create a pandas dataframe from a series
How To Easily Create A Pandas DataFrame From A Series
December 3, 2025 - This approach requires two primary steps: ensuring each Series is converted into a temporary single-column DataFrame, and then merging these temporary structures together using concatenation. Suppose we are tracking basic statistics for a group of individuals.
🌐
GeeksforGeeks
geeksforgeeks.org › convert-given-pandas-series-into-a-dataframe-with-its-index-as-another-column-on-the-dataframe
Convert given Pandas series into a dataframe with its index as another column on the dataframe - GeeksforGeeks
August 17, 2020 - Each row in a dataframe (i.e level=0) ... value from 0 to n-1 index location and there are many ways to convert these index values into a column in a pandas dataframe. First, let's create a Pandas dataframe. Here, we will create a Pandas dataframe regarding student's marks in a pa · 4 min read How to Convert Pandas DataFrame columns to a Series...
🌐
w3resource
w3resource.com › python-exercises › pandas › python-pandas-data-series-exercise-36.php
Pandas Data Series: Convert given series into a dataframe with its index as another column on the dataframe - w3resource
df = num_ser.to_frame().reset_index(): This code converts the Pandas Series 'num_ser' to a Pandas DataFrame using the to_frame() method, which returns a DataFrame with the Series values as a single column and the Series index as the index of ...
🌐
Favtutor
favtutor.com › articles › convert-pandas-series-to-dataframe
Convert Pandas Series to DataFrame (3 Methods with Examples)
December 1, 2023 - By passing the Series object as the first argument and providing the column names as a list, we can create a DataFrame with the Series values assigned to the specified column. ... import pandas as pd # Create a Series s = pd.Series([1, 2, 3, ...
🌐
GeeksforGeeks
geeksforgeeks.org › how-to-convert-pandas-dataframe-columns-to-a-series
How to Convert Pandas DataFrame columns to a Series? - GeeksforGeeks
October 1, 2020 - When a part of any column in Dataframe is important and the need is to take it separate, we can split a column on the basis of the requirement. We can use Pandas .str accessor, it does fast vectorized string operations for Series and Dataframes and returns a string object. Pandas str accessor has nu ... Let's see how can we retrieve the unique values from pandas dataframe. Let's create a dataframe from CSV file. We are using the past data of GDP from different countries. You can get the dataset from here. Python3 # import pandas as pd import pandas as pd gapminder_csv_url ='http://bit.ly/2cLzoxH' #
🌐
Pandas
pandas.pydata.org › docs › user_guide › dsintro.html
Intro to data structures — pandas 3.0.3 documentation - PyData |
Series.array will always be an ExtensionArray. Briefly, an ExtensionArray is a thin wrapper around one or more concrete arrays like a numpy.ndarray. pandas knows how to take an ExtensionArray and store it in a Series or a column of a DataFrame.
🌐
Data Science Dojo
discuss.datasciencedojo.com › python
How to transform a Pandas Series index into a DataFrame column? - Python - Data Science Dojo Discussions
February 16, 2023 - I have faced this problem several times and found a way to solve it using the reset_index() method in Pandas. This method adds a new sequential index to the series and converts the previous index into a column.
🌐
Note.nkmk.me
note.nkmk.me › home › python › pandas
pandas: Convert between DataFrame and Series | note.nkmk.me
January 20, 2024 - Rows and columns of DataFrame can be retrieved as Series using [], loc[], or iloc[]. Refer to the following articles for details. pandas: Select rows/columns by index (numbers and names)